Our verdict is Uncertain significance. The variant received 0 ACMG points: 0P and 0B.
The NM_004369.4(COL6A3):c.3741G>T(p.Glu1247Asp) variant causes a missense change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.00000992 in 1,613,186 control chromosomes in the GnomAD database, with no homozygous occurrence. Variant has been reported in ClinVar as Uncertain significance (★). Another nucleotide change resulting in the same amino acid substitution has been previously reported as Uncertain significance in ClinVar. Synonymous variant affecting the same amino acid position (i.e. E1247E) has been classified as Likely benign.

Bethlem myopathy 1A Uncertain:1
In summary, the available evidence is currently insufficient to determine the role of this variant in disease. Therefore, it has been classified as a Variant of Uncertain Significance. Advanced modeling of protein sequence and biophysical properties (such as structural, functional, and spatial information, amino acid conservation, physicochemical variation, residue mobility, and thermodynamic stability) performed at Invitae indicates that this missense variant is not expected to disrupt COL6A3 protein function. This variant has not been reported in the literature in individuals affected with COL6A3-related conditions. This variant is present in population databases (rs577927810, gnomAD 0.03%). This sequence change replaces glutamic acid, which is acidic and polar, with aspartic acid, which is acidic and polar, at codon 1247 of the COL6A3 protein (p.Glu1247Asp). -
